免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发范围说明书

移动应用程序开发范围指的是开发、设计、测试和部署应用程序以便可以在智能手机、平板电脑和其他移动设备上运行。移动应用程序开发是一项相对新的技术,但因为越来越多的人使用智能手机、平板电脑和其他移动设备,移动应用程序开发变得越来越重要。

移动应用程序开发通常涉及以下几个方面:

1.应用程序开发平台

开发应用程序所需的主要工具是应用程序开发平台。应用程序开发平台通常包括一组开发工具、库和框架,用于开发、测试和调试应用程序。开发平台可以是原生移动应用程序开发工具,例如 iOS 开发工具包和 Android 软件开发包 (SDK),也可以是跨平台移动应用程序开发框架,例如 React Native 和 Ionic。

2.设计

设计一个引人注目的、功能强大的移动应用程序需要一些专业的设计工具。这些工具可以帮助设计师创建应用程序的用户界面和用户体验。设计师们通常使用设计工具来制作应用程序的草图,并创建可交互的原型。设计工具通常包括适用于移动设备的视觉元素和图标库。

3.编程语言和编程技术

移动应用程序可以使用多种编程语言和编程技术编写。原生应用程序开发通常使用 Java、Objective-C 和 Swift 这样的编程语言。跨平台应用程序开发使用各种语言、框架和库,例如 JavaScript、HTML、CSS、React 和 Angular。

4.服务器端开发

移动应用程序通常需要进行服务器端开发,这可以确保应用程序可以与后端系统通信、存储和检索数据等。服务器端开发可以使用多种语言和技术,包括 php、Java、NodeJS、Ruby 和 Python,以及各种数据库,包括 MySQL 和 MongoDB 等。

5.测试和部署

测试是移动应用程序开发的一个重要方面,因为开发人员必须确保应用程序可以在各种设备和操作系统上正常运行,并保证应用程序和后端系统的安全性。开发人员通常使用模拟器和真实设备进行测试。一旦应用程序经过测试并准备好发布,那么它就可以被部署到计算机或移动设备上。

总之,移动应用程序开发范围非常广泛,需要涵盖多个方面,包括可视化设计、编程语言、跨平台技术、服务器端开发、测试和部署等。开发高质量的移动应用程序需要团队中的全体成员协同工作,共同保证应用程序的安全性、稳定性和用户体验。


相关知识:
软件app开发外包价格
软件开发外包是指企业将软件开发的任务委托给外部的专业软件开发公司或个人完成的过程。由于企业本身没有软件开发的能力或技术实力,或者是为了提高效率和降低成本,所以选择将软件开发外包给专业的软件开发公司或个人。那么软件开发外包的价格是如何计算的呢?下面我们来详细
2024-01-10
app开发运营基数怎么算
App开发运营基数是指在开发和运营一个App所需要的基础资源和要素。它包括了人力资源、财务资源、技术资源、市场资源等方面。下面我将详细介绍每个方面的计算原理和方法。1. 人力资源:人力资源是App开发运营中最重要的资源之一。计算人力资源的基数可以从以下几个
2023-06-29
app开发之帖子
App开发是指开发移动应用程序的过程,它可以在智能手机、平板电脑和其他移动设备上运行。随着智能手机的普及,移动应用程序的需求也越来越大,因此学习和掌握App开发技术变得越来越重要。App开发的原理涉及多个方面,包括前端开发、后端开发、数据库设计等等。下面我
2023-06-29
app开发的技术路线怎样写
App开发技术路线是一个涉及多个方面的复杂过程,需要掌握多种技术和工具才能完成。以下是app开发技术路线的详细介绍:1.确定app开发的目标和模式在开始开发app之前,需要确定app的目标和模式。目标是指app的主要功能、目标用户和受众人群。模式是指app
2023-06-29
apple store 开发者
Apple Store开发者是指从事在苹果公司旗下的App Store平台上发布、开发、更新、维护和支持iOS应用程序的专业人士。作为全球知名的移动应用程序开发平台,App Store提供了一整套完整的开发工具、资源和服务,以便开发者将各种类型的应用程序发
2023-05-06
appcan开发使用jpush
Appcan是一个专注于移动应用程序开发的全方位解决方案供应商。JPush是一款专门针对移动应用推送的云服务。结合使用可以实现推送功能,以下是关于使用JPush在Appcan中开发应用时的原理和详细介绍。一、JPush的原理JPush是极光推送推出的服务之
2023-05-06